现象:
在移动互联网高速发展的今天,视频类应用已成为用户获取信息与娱乐的主流方式。无论是短视频、长视频还是直播平台,用户对视频内容的流畅性、清晰度与交互体验提出了更高要求。而支撑这一切的,正是背后...
现象:
在移动互联网高速发展的今天,视频类应用已成为用户获取信息与娱乐的主流方式。无论是短视频、长视频还是直播平台,用户对视频内容的流畅性、清晰度与交互体验提出了更高要求。而支撑这一切的,正是背后的“
成品视频APP系统”以及其复杂的“
系统设计”与“
系统集成”。但很多企业在搭建“视频平台”时,常面临系统卡顿、扩展困难、服务宕机等问题,尤其在流量高峰期,系统稳定性成为最大挑战。那么,一个高可用、高性能的“
成品视频系统”究竟该如何设计?其核心在于科学合理的“系统架构”,尤其是“负载均衡”策略的运用。
原理:
一个稳定的成品视频APP系统,其底层依赖于一套完善的系统架构设计。该架构不仅包括前端展示层、业务逻辑层、数据存储层,还涵盖视频转码、内容分发、用户管理、推荐算法等多个功能模块。在“系统设计”中,首先要明确各组件的职责与交互关系,比如视频上传模块、转码处理模块、CDN分发模块、用户行为分析模块等,它们共同构成完整的“
管理系统”。
其中,“负载均衡”是保障系统高并发处理能力的关键技术。通过将用户请求均匀分配到多个服务器节点,避免单点压力过大导致服务崩溃。常用的负载均衡策略包括轮询、加权轮询、IP哈希、最小连接数等,结合硬件负载均衡器(如F5)或软件方案(如Nginx、HAProxy),根据实际业务需求灵活配置。此外,微服务架构的引入,也让系统具备更高的灵活性与可维护性,每个服务独立部署与扩展,进一步增强了整体系统的弹性。
应用:
以某知名短视频平台为例,其“成品视频系统”采用了分层分布式架构,前端通过CDN加速视频内容分发,后端则利用Kubernetes进行容器编排,实现自动扩缩容。在“系统集成”方面,该平台将用户管理、内容审核、广告投放、数据分析等多个子系统无缝对接,形成统一的“管理系统”,提升了运营效率。
具体来说,该系统在“负载均衡”上做了多层设计:在接入层,使用LVS+Keepalived实现四层负载均衡;在应用层,通过Nginx实现七层路由与反向代理,并根据实时监控数据动态调整流量分配;在存储层,采用分布式文件系统与对象存储方案,确保海量视频数据的高效存取。此外,系统还引入了智能调度算法,根据用户地理位置、网络状态与服务器负载情况,自动选择最优节点进行内容传输,极大优化了用户体验。
发展:
随着5G、AI与边缘计算的普及,未来的“成品视频系统”将更加智能化与分布式。一方面,AI技术将深度融入视频推荐、内容理解与自动化审核中,提升平台的精准运营能力;另一方面,边缘计算将有效降低延迟,提高视频播放的实时性与流畅度,这对“系统设计”提出了更高要求。
同时,“系统集成”的范围也将不断扩大,从单一的内容管理延伸至用户画像、社交互动、电商变现等多个维度,形成一体化的“管理系统”。在这一过程中,“负载均衡”技术将不断演进,从传统基于硬件的方案向软件定义与AI驱动的智能调度转变,以应对更加复杂多变的业务场景。
总结而言,一个稳定、高效的成品视频APP系统,离不开科学的“系统设计”、合理的“系统集成”与先进的“负载均衡”策略。只有从系统工程的角度出发,深入分析各组件间的协作关系,才能打造出真正满足用户需求、具备高可用性与扩展性的“成品视频系统”与“视频平台”。这不仅是技术问题,更是系统思维与工程能力的综合体现。
魅思视频团队将继续致力为用户提供最优质的视频平台解决方案,感谢您的持续关注和支持!